Global software and engineering technology company is looking to expand its software engineering team in Cambridge. You will be working on a range of new development projects for a significant public facing web/cloud platform that is used extensively across the globe by the engineering industries and communities. The are looking to hire Full Stack Software Engineers who can work as part of cross functional teams that design, develop, and maintain scalable web services.
Key Skills/experience Required
* Proven experience as a Full-stack Software Engineer or in a similar development role; at least 4+ years of experience in Full-stack web application development
* Having concrete experience in UI development with TypeScript
* Having concrete experience in Backend Development with Node.JS or Go, Python
* Understanding common software design principles and patterns.
* Problem-solving and analytical skills; able to understand complex business processes and system workflows
* Able to communicate clearly with other engineers and non-technical stakeholders
* A strong sense of product ownership.
Technical Expertise Required
* Advanced knowledge of front-end development using TypeScript and React. Experience in Next.JS is a plus
* Proficient in developing Backend Services with Node or Go/Python
* Interfacing/designing web services with “Top-Down”/ “Schema-First” approach. Having experience in GraphQL is a significant plus
* Understanding of common Relational Database (e.g. MySQL)
* Experience in containerized development, CI/CD, and Kubernetes is a plus
* A good understanding of Elasticsearch is beneficial
Please note this is an onsite role, so you will need to be happy to commute to the Cambridge office 5 days per week. They have very modern well equipped offices with plenty of parking available.
This is an opportunity to work on development projects where you can really add value!
If you are interested, please apply to Matt Andrews at IC Resources
#J-18808-Ljbffr